Transaction 5f3c64c6246e92b35c091c11150f44eb5a41e78046df96a29e35055cd56e0620
2 Input
2 Outputs
- 5f3c64c6246e92b35c091c11150f44eb5a41e78046df96a29e35055cd56e0620:0
- 5f3c64c6246e92b35c091c11150f44eb5a41e78046df96a29e35055cd56e0620:1
value 100000000
address 1Db7Ppw9CXfLDvrW5ZMWYC2jdorC3pedtZ
value 220780
address 18H1p4vHF4ArZf8NqcUpWuDrazZBdtWSoY